Output c93009d428ec73deacf21802b7aa38351f776c6cd47f5c4ff39c5d51fefece6c:2

value
2102696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e1ef9ec75aefbba169190a1705460f14200585e OP_EQUAL
address
3DBtAyxwsdoKryrDv1dBKeiJuTmHFZ8LMM
transaction
c93009d428ec73deacf21802b7aa38351f776c6cd47f5c4ff39c5d51fefece6c
spent
true